Advisory Software QA Engineer

4 weeks ago


Pittsburgh, Pennsylvania, United States ZOLL Cardiac Management Solutions Full time

Software Quality Assurance Engineer - Cardiac Management Solutions

ZOLL Cardiac Management Solutions is seeking a skilled Software Quality Assurance Engineer to join our team. As a Software Quality Assurance Engineer, you will be responsible for the development, execution, and maintenance of software test plans, test cases, and test reporting.

Key Responsibilities:

  • Lead testing activities for projects and provide status on those activities
  • Test software running on safety-critical medical devices and associated applications
  • Design and review test plans and test cases
  • Execute and maintain test plans and test cases to verify the design meets the specified requirements
  • Identify and communicate risk throughout the software development lifecycle and work cross-functionally to mitigate risk
  • Identify and point out ambiguities in requirements
  • Generate detailed defect reports for failed tests
  • Assist Development teams with the troubleshooting of defects
  • Facilitate cross-functional defect, test plan, and test case reviews
  • Provide estimates on the test effort for work items
  • Participate in program, design, and document reviews
  • Mentor and train new and less experienced staff members
  • Research and develop a solid understanding of the proposed requirements and engineering specifications for the product features being implemented
  • Adhere to department software release schedules
  • Comply with regulatory guidelines and maintain associated documentation
  • Ensure and document traceability from requirements to tests
  • Monitor test automation results for assigned application
  • Develop and maintain automated test scripts
  • Work closely with automation test engineers to define automated test processes and tools to support device verification/validation testing
  • Recommend new solutions, processes, and tools to improve testing capabilities and efficiency

Requirements:

  • BS or MS degree required or equivalent industry experience in a related Engineering, Computer Science, or other STEM discipline required
  • 10+ years of relevant experience required and proven track record performing the above duties and responsibilities required
  • Experience writing SQL queries required and experience with scripting languages such as Bash, Python, or PowerShell required
  • Experience working with Linux OS file system required and experience testing web services using tools such as Postman, SoapUI, Swagger required
  • Experience testing medical devices and familiar with relevant software quality regulations and standards required

Knowledge, Skills, and Abilities:

  • Language Skills: Ability to read and interpret documents of advanced technical complexity. Ability to write reports and research findings of a technical nature. Ability to speak and present effectively one-on-one as well as in small and large groups of professionals including customers, clients, and collaborators, both inside and outside the organization.
  • Mathematical Skills: Basic mathematical skills required, including the understanding and ability to apply basic statistical and arithmetic principles, work with tabular data, and create and interpret graphs.
  • Reasoning Ability: Advanced reasoning skills required. Must have the ability to solve complex problems and weigh possible solutions to determine rank options to deliver optimal outcomes. Ability to assess problems involving several variables in changing situations.
  • Computer Skills: To perform this job successfully, an individual should be proficient in Microsoft Office Suite.

Physical Demands:

  • While performing the duties of this Job, the employee is regularly required to sit and talk or hear. The employee is occasionally required to stand and walk.

Working Conditions:

  • This position is generally performed in a typical office environment that is usually quiet. Employee is expected to work collaboratively with team members, as well as able to work independently with limited supervision. Work will require significant computer and telephone work.

ZOLL Cardiac Management Solutions is a fast-growing company that operates in more than 140 countries around the world. Our employees are inspired by a commitment to make a difference in patients' lives, and our culture values innovation, self-motivation, and an entrepreneurial spirit. Join us in our efforts to improve outcomes for underserved patients suffering from critical cardiopulmonary conditions and help save more lives.

All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.



  • Pittsburgh, Pennsylvania, United States ZOLL Services LLC (on SAM site) Full time

    Job SummaryThis position will be responsible for the development, execution, and maintenance of software test plans, test cases, and test reporting.The ideal candidate will possess experience with software testing in all phases of the software development lifecycle, including industry-accepted software quality assurance standards and methodologies.This...


  • Pittsburgh, Pennsylvania, United States ZOLL Services LLC (on SAM site) Full time

    Job SummaryThis position will be responsible for the development, execution and maintenance of software test plans, test cases and test reporting.This individual must possess experience with software testing in all phases of the software development lifecycle.The candidate must have in-depth knowledge of industry accepted software quality assurance standards...


  • Pittsburgh, Pennsylvania, United States ZOLL Cardiac Management Solutions Full time

    At ZOLL Cardiac Management Solutions, we're passionate about improving patient outcomes and helping save lives. Our medical devices, software, and related services are used worldwide to diagnose and treat patients suffering from serious cardiopulmonary and respiratory conditions.Key Responsibilities:Develop, execute, and maintain software test plans, test...


  •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    About the RoleWe're seeking a talented engineer to join our team at the Software Engineering Institute. As an Embedded Software Engineer, you'll play a critical role in designing and developing software prototypes and research methods for software resilience.You'll work closely with our team to develop tools, techniques, and processes to solve some of the...


  •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    Job SummaryThe Software Engineering Institute (SEI) is seeking a highly skilled Senior Software Engineer to join our team. As a key member of our Applied Systems Group, you will be responsible for conceiving, developing, testing, and deploying software systems to improve the capabilities of our customers.You will participate in all phases of the software...

  • Software Engineer

    4 weeks ago


    Pittsburgh, Pennsylvania, United States Lynx Software Technologies Full time

    Job OverviewWe are seeking a highly skilled Software Engineer to join our team at Lynx Software Technologies. As a key member of our development team, you will be responsible for designing, developing, and implementing software solutions using Python.Key ResponsibilitiesDesign and develop high-quality software applications using PythonCollaborate with...


  • Pittsburgh, Pennsylvania, United States Govini Full time

    Job DescriptionWe are seeking a skilled and dedicated Software Engineering Lead to join our Engineering team at Govini.As the Software Engineering Lead, you will be responsible for crafting and implementing software engineering processes and implementations within Govini.You will lead software engineering efforts from ideation through implementation, as well...

  • Software Engineer

    3 weeks ago


    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    Job SummaryWe are seeking a highly skilled Software Engineer to join our Advanced Computing Lab team at the Software Engineering Institute. As a key member of our team, you will apply the latest software and advanced computing research and leading-edge technologies to important and challenging government problems and needs.Key ResponsibilitiesDesign and...


  • Pittsburgh, Pennsylvania, United States Govini Full time

    Govini is seeking a skilled Software Engineering Lead to join our Engineering team.As the Software Engineering Lead at Govini, you will be essential to crafting and implementing the software engineering processes and implementations within Govini.You must be obsessed with quality, and efficiency, and love working with diverse technologies.Our ideal candidate...


  • Pittsburgh, Pennsylvania, United States Pyramid Consulting Group Full time

    Job SummaryAt Pyramid Consulting Group, we are seeking a highly skilled Sr. .NET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and deploying scalable and efficient software solutions using the .NET Core framework.Responsibilities• Design and develop microservices...


  • Pittsburgh, Pennsylvania, United States Govini Full time

    Job DescriptionWe are seeking a skilled and dedicated Software Engineering Lead to join our Engineering team at Govini. As the Software Engineering Lead, you will be essential to crafting and implementing the software engineering processes and implementations within Govini.In order to do this job well, you must be obsessed with quality, and efficiency, and...


  • Pittsburgh, Pennsylvania, United States Net Health Full time

    About Net HealthWe are a high-growth and profitable company that helps caregivers harness data for human health. Our welcoming and collaborative culture paired with progressive benefits makes Net Health the ultimate career home.As a leading-edge SaaS company in healthcare, we deliver solutions that help patients get better, faster, and live more fulfilling...


  • Pittsburgh, Pennsylvania, United States StarsHR, Inc. Full time

    Key Responsibilities:We are seeking a highly skilled Software Verification and Validation Engineer to join our team at StarsHR, Inc. The ideal candidate will have a minimum of 8 years of relevant work experience in software testing, software engineering, requirement engineering, and/or risk engineering in healthcare software development or other regulated...


  • Pittsburgh, Pennsylvania, United States Maintec Technologies Full time

    Job SummaryAt Maintec Technologies, we are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our development team, you will be responsible for designing and building high-performance web and desktop applications using Angular. Your expertise in JavaScript, HTML, CSS, and TypeScript will enable you to deliver complex...


  •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    Software Engineering Institute Overview:The Software Engineering Institute (SEI) is a national resource that helps advance software engineering principles and practices. We work closely with academia, defense and government organizations, and industry to continually improve software-intensive systems.Job Summary:We are seeking a qualified Senior Software...


  • Pittsburgh, Pennsylvania, United States Jobot Full time

    Job DetailsDice is the leading career destination for tech experts at every stage of their careers. Our client, Jobot, is seeking a skilled professional to join their growing engineering team.Job SummaryJobot is an analytics company that was recently acquired by a giant in the industry. This has been a great moment for us because we still operate...


  •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    About the Role:The Software Engineering Institute (SEI) is seeking a highly skilled Sr. Software Developer to join our team. As a key member of our software development team, you will be responsible for designing and developing software prototypes, researching methodologies for software resilience, and developing methodologies to advance the practice of...


  •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    About the RoleWe're seeking a talented software engineer to join our team at the Software Engineering Institute. As a key member of our team, you'll be responsible for designing and developing software prototypes and research methods for software resilience.Our ideal candidate has experience with software engineering, RTOS scheduling, and memory management....


  • Pittsburgh, Pennsylvania, United States Software Engineering Institute Full time

    About the RoleWe are seeking a skilled software engineer to join our team at the Software Engineering Institute. As an embedded software systems engineer, you will be responsible for designing and developing software prototypes and research methods for software resilience.Key ResponsibilitiesDesign embedded software tools and capabilities, including software...

  • Software Engineer

    4 weeks ago


    Pittsburgh, Pennsylvania, United States Net Health Full time

    About Net HealthWe're a high-growth and profitable company that helps caregivers harness data for human health. Our welcoming and collaborative culture, paired with progressive benefits, makes Net Health the ultimate career home.As a leading-edge SaaS company in healthcare, we deliver solutions that help patients get better, faster, and live more fulfilling...